Rockwell’s linear motor subsidiary Anorad is introducing brushless linear positioning systems and components. One drive, aimed at applications such as pick-and-place robots, is capable of 6m/s velocity and 6G acceleration.

Baldor’s energy efficient motors comply with Eff1 and Eff2 efficiency ratings. Some of the Super-E motors have efficiencies above 96%. Baldor reports that another key market for the company is that for its ‘intelligent drive’.

New from vacon is an AC inverter with separate power and control sections, credit card sized I/O modules, an external 24V DC supply to test control functions without mains power, and built in EMC filters.
